云计算的基础知识和应用领域

柔情密语酱 2022-06-25 ⋅ 11 阅读

简介

云计算是一种基于网络的计算模式,通过网络将大量的计算资源集中管理并提供给用户使用。它提供了高度灵活、可扩展的计算能力,为用户提供了便捷的计算服务。本文将介绍云计算的基础知识和应用领域。

云计算的基础知识

云计算基于虚拟化技术,将物理计算资源(如服务器、存储设备等)虚拟化成多个逻辑资源,用户可以按需使用这些资源。云计算包含以下几个基本概念:

1. 服务模型

云计算提供了不同的服务模型,包括:基础设施即服务(IaaS)、平台即服务(PaaS)和软件即服务(SaaS)。

  • IaaS:提供了基本的计算资源,如服务器、存储空间和网络设备,用户可以根据需求自由配置和管理这些资源。
  • PaaS:在IaaS的基础上,还提供了开发和部署应用程序所需的开发工具和平台,简化了应用程序的开发和运维工作。
  • SaaS:提供了完整的应用程序,用户只需通过互联网访问即可使用这些应用程序,无需关心底层的基础设施和平台。

2. 部署模式

云计算提供了不同的部署模式,包括:公有云、私有云和混合云。

  • 公有云:计算资源由第三方服务提供商管理和维护,用户通过互联网进行访问和使用。公有云具有高度的可扩展性和灵活性,适用于大多数应用场景。
  • 私有云:计算资源由用户自己管理和维护,可以部署在本地数据中心或者专用的云服务器上。私有云提供了更高的安全性和可定制性,适用于对数据安全有较高要求的企业。
  • 混合云:将公有云和私有云进行结合,通过互联网络进行资源共享和数据传输。混合云提供了更大的弹性和灵活性,适用于在不同业务场景下的需求。

3. 优势和挑战

云计算具有以下优势:

  • 灵活性和可扩展性:用户可以根据需求调整计算资源的规模,避免了资源浪费和过度投资。
  • 高可用性和容灾性:云计算提供了冗余和备份机制,确保用户的应用程序和数据不易丢失。
  • 成本效益:用户只需按需付费,无需购买和维护昂贵的硬件设备,节省了大量的成本和时间。

然而,云计算也面临着一些挑战:

  • 安全性:用户的数据和隐私存储在云中,可能面临泄露和攻击的风险。
  • 延迟和性能:由于云计算基于网络,用户在访问和使用计算资源时可能面临网络延迟和性能问题。
  • 依赖性:用户对云计算提供商有一定的依赖性,一旦出现服务故障或者提供商倒闭,可能导致业务中断。

云计算的应用领域

云计算广泛应用于各个领域,包括但不限于以下几个方面:

1. 企业应用

企业可以通过云计算提供的SaaS来实现各种应用,如企业资源规划(ERP)、客户关系管理(CRM)等。云计算提供了简单、易用和可定制的应用服务,为企业提供了高效的管理和协作工具。

2. 大数据分析

云计算提供了强大的计算资源和存储能力,为大数据分析提供了理想的平台。通过云计算,用户可以快速处理和分析大量的数据,提取有价值的信息和见解,为业务决策提供参考。

3. 人工智能和机器学习

云计算为人工智能和机器学习提供了计算和存储的基础设施。通过云计算,用户可以访问强大的计算能力和深度学习框架,快速构建和训练模型,并将其部署到生产环境中。

4. 互联网服务

云计算为互联网服务提供了高可用、高扩展的基础设施。通过云计算,互联网企业可以快速部署和扩展应用程序,提供稳定和可靠的服务。

5. IoT(物联网)

互联网物联网的普及和发展,需要强大的计算能力和大规模的数据处理能力。云计算可提供可靠而灵活的计算资源,以满足物联网设备和应用程序的需求。

总结

云计算是一种基于网络的计算模式,为用户提供高度灵活、可扩展的计算能力。它具有多种服务模型和部署模式,适用于各个领域的应用。在企业应用、数据分析、人工智能、互联网服务和物联网等领域,云计算都发挥了重要的作用。然而,随着云计算的普及,也需要解决安全性、延迟性和依赖性等挑战,以确保用户的数据和服务安全可靠。


全部评论: 0

    我有话说: